Our new X account is live! Follow @wizwand_team for updates
WorkDL logo mark

Collaborative Retrieval for Large Language Model-based Conversational Recommender Systems

About

Conversational recommender systems (CRS) aim to provide personalized recommendations via interactive dialogues with users. While large language models (LLMs) enhance CRS with their superior understanding of context-aware user preferences, they typically struggle to leverage behavioral data, which have proven to be important for classical collaborative filtering (CF)-based approaches. For this reason, we propose CRAG, Collaborative Retrieval Augmented Generation for LLM-based CRS. To the best of our knowledge, CRAG is the first approach that combines state-of-the-art LLMs with CF for conversational recommendations. Our experiments on two publicly available movie conversational recommendation datasets, i.e., a refined Reddit dataset (which we name Reddit-v2) as well as the Redial dataset, demonstrate the superior item coverage and recommendation performance of CRAG, compared to several CRS baselines. Moreover, we observe that the improvements are mainly due to better recommendation accuracy on recently released movies. The code and data are available at https://github.com/yaochenzhu/CRAG.

Yaochen Zhu, Chao Wan, Harald Steck, Dawen Liang, Yesu Feng, Nathan Kallus, Jundong Li• 2025

Related benchmarks

TaskDatasetResultRank
Conversational RecommendationREDIAL
Recall@50.2097
40
Conversational RecommendationREDDIT V2 (test)
Recall@511.46
26
Conversational RecommendationREDDIT V2
Recall@511.46
23
Showing 3 of 3 rows

Other info

Follow for update